Output 00f23e13645b6e842a3793021af1e2deac62f529d31d5b8fb3650d289776968c:1

value
100136160
script pubkey
OP_0 OP_PUSHBYTES_20 ddbef002115f5330089a7cc5e77535e2d0e733fa
address
bc1qmkl0qqs3tafnqzy60nz7waf4utgwwvl6p0kdvt
transaction
00f23e13645b6e842a3793021af1e2deac62f529d31d5b8fb3650d289776968c
spent
true